TitleSt Mary's Church of EnglandDescriptionThe Anglican Church of St Mary the Virgin is situated in Sutton Street Redcliffe. The land was originally purchased by the Reverend John Sutton and donated to the Church in 1881. This photo shows the first St Mary's, a simple timber building dedicated by the Bishop of Brisbane, the Right Reverend W.T. Thornhill Webber on 22 December 1898. This building was moved to Clontarf in 1959, rebuilt, and named St Barnabas' Church, Clontarf.Date1952Record typePhotographFormat typePhysicalOriginal format colourBlack and whiteOriginal format dimensions10.5cm x 9cm
